Description In this paper, authors have presented design of a simple, novel helix SWS (HSWS) for flat power and gain frequency response with improved electronic efficiency in the X-band. To control the dispersion of the structure, the helix is supported with two different types of dielectric supports, namely, T and rectangular shaped and as a consequence flat power and gain have been achieved.
